Allen-Bradley 1746-P1 SLC 500 Power Supply | Replacement, Equivalent & Selection Guide
The Allen-Bradley 1746-P1 is a standard AC power supply designed for the SLC 500 modular chassis family. It delivers regulated DC power to the backplane, supporting a wide range of I/O and specialty modules. Compatible Replacement & Equivalent Models
When the original 1746-P1 is unavailable or cost-prohibitive, the following models are commonly evaluated as replacements. Always verify electrical ratings and chassis compatibility before substitution.
| Model | Brand | Input | 5 VDC Output | 24 VDC Output | Notes |
|---|---|---|---|---|---|
| 1746-P1 | Allen-Bradley | 85–265 VAC | 5 A | 0.96 A | Original — recommended |
| 1746-P2 | Allen-Bradley | 85–265 VAC | 10 A | 0.96 A | Higher 5 V capacity; drop-in upgrade |
| 1746-P3 | Allen-Bradley | 85–265 VAC | 16 A | 0.96 A | High-density chassis applications |
| 1746-P4 | Allen-Bradley | 24 VDC | 10 A | 0.96 A | DC input variant; different wiring |
| 1746-P5 | Allen-Bradley | 24 VDC | 5 A | 0.96 A | DC input, same capacity as P1 |
| 1746-P6 | Allen-Bradley | 85–265 VAC | 10 A | 1.5 A | Enhanced 24 V user power |
| 1746-P7 | Allen-Bradley | 85–265 VAC | 10 A | 2.88 A | Maximum user power output |

System Compatibility
The 1746-P1 is compatible with the following SLC 500 system components:
- Chassis: 1746-A4 (4-slot), 1746-A7 (7-slot), 1746-A10 (10-slot), 1746-A13 (13-slot)
- Processors: 1747-L20, 1747-L30, 1747-L40, 1747-L511, 1747-L514, 1747-L524, 1747-L531, 1747-L532, 1747-L541, 1747-L542, 1747-L543, 1747-L551, 1747-L552, 1747-L553
- I/O Modules: All standard 1746-series digital and analog I/O modules
- Programming Software: RSLogix 500, RSLogix Micro
- Communication: Compatible with DH-485, DeviceNet, and EtherNet/IP adapter modules in the same chassis
⚠ Verify total backplane current draw does not exceed 5 A (5 VDC bus) before finalizing chassis configuration.
Selection Guide
Use the following decision framework to select the correct SLC 500 power supply:
| Requirement | Recommended Model |
|---|---|
| AC input, ≤5 A backplane load, standard 24 V user power | 1746-P1 ✓ |
| AC input, 5–10 A backplane load | 1746-P2 or 1746-P6 |
| AC input, >10 A backplane load (high-density chassis) | 1746-P3 |
| DC input (24 VDC plant power), ≤5 A load | 1746-P5 |
| DC input, 5–10 A load | 1746-P4 |
| AC input, high 24 VDC user power demand (>1 A) | 1746-P6 or 1746-P7 |
How to calculate backplane load: Sum the 5 VDC current draw of all installed modules (listed in each module’s datasheet). Add 10% margin. If total exceeds 5 A, upgrade to 1746-P2 or higher.

Replacement & Compatibility FAQ
Q: Can I replace a 1746-P1 with a 1746-P2 without any configuration changes?
A: Yes. The 1746-P2 is a direct drop-in replacement with higher 5 VDC capacity. No software or wiring changes are required.
Q: Will the 1746-P1 work in a 1746-A13 (13-slot) chassis?
A: It depends on your module configuration. The 13-slot chassis can draw more than 5 A if fully populated. Calculate your backplane load first — if it exceeds 5 A, use the 1746-P2 or P3.
Q: Is the 1746-P1 compatible with SLC 5/05 (Ethernet) processors?
A: Yes. The 1746-P1 powers the backplane regardless of processor type, including the 1747-L551/552/553 (SLC 5/05) series.

Q: What happens if the power supply fails?
A: The SLC 500 processor will fault and halt program execution. The 1746-P1 has a built-in fault indicator LED. Replace the unit and perform a controlled restart per your site’s maintenance procedure.
